OK Ed....In brief:

There are 4 struts on each car........one each behind each wheel.

They act like shock absorbers. What a "brace" does is link the two front struts (the right one and the left) and the two rear to each other other via a stiff metal bar.

This bar reduces chassis flexing thus improving handling.

Now try this: Take your two index fingers and hold them about 6" apart. Wiggle them around. Easy, right ?

Now pick up a pen or pencil and place the ends of it on the end of each finger. Now wiggle those fingers. See how much more difficult it is and how thet now move in unison ?

That's it !
